How Transaction Sides Are Calculated
In real estate, agent productivity is often measured by “sides”, which is a shorter way of saying transaction sides. A typical real estate transaction has two sides being represented, the buyer and seller. Usually, each side has their own representation, but it is possible for one agent to handle...
